This is a photograph of the Shah-i-Zinda necropolis in Samarkand, Uzbekistan, taken on a clear, sunny day. The image primarily features a grand, intricately tiled portal with an arched entryway. The facade is adorned with geometric patterns and calligraphy in shades of blue, turquoise, and ochre. A wide set of marble stairs leads up to the entrance, flanked by potted plants and informational signs. To the left of the portal is a section of a light-colored brick building with wooden window frames and a domed roof partially visible. To the right, another brick building is visible with windows and stairs leading up to it. The sky is a clear, bright blue. No people are visible in the image.
